2016-07-10 3 views
0

Я не знаю, что происходит в браузере для настольных компьютеров, но в браузере по умолчанию для Android, когда я сохраняю ширину и высоту как 100% Размер шрифта текстового поля увеличивается в соответствии с screen Я попытался предупредить размер шрифта в текстовом поле, но он не изменяется. Я думаю, что это ошибка в браузере, если нет способа устранить эту проблему?textarea изменяет размер шрифта в соответствии с размером экрана

Любая помощь будет оценена по достоинству.

Код это просто:

<textarea></textarea> 
<style> 
    textarea{ 
    width:100%; 
    height:100%; 
    font-size:16px; 
    } 
</style> 
<script> 
    alert($("textarea").css("font-size"));//uses jquery 
    //Outputs 16 
</script> 

Я заметил, что размер шрифта начинает меняться после того, как ширина становится больше, чем ~ 450px

ответ

0

я думаю, что проблемы, связанные с:

<meta name="viewport" content="width=device-width, initial-scale=1"> 

просто отметьте <head> тег и удалите его, если есть - не рекомендуется -

  • другая причина может быть связана с cssmedia Query проверки запросы средств массовой информации в stylesheet и изменить Отключить масштабирование font-size
+0

Я удалил его .. это не работает –

2
<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=no" /> 

.

+1

В соответствии с линиями обеспечения доступности мы не должны отключать масштабирование, это недружелюбно относится к зрению. –

+0

Я хочу сделать это, но на самом деле я не хочу, чтобы меня настраивали на просмотр, хотя настройка на видовое окно действительно решает проблему, потому что ширина экрана становится меньше 450 пикселей :( –

Смежные вопросы